§ 17-156 — Joint city and school district facility; acquisition of land; erection, equipment, furnishings, and maintenance
Nebraska·Ch. 17 Cities of the Second Class and Villages
Any school district in this state which has within its boundaries, or is contiguous to, a city of the second class may, together with such city, jointly acquire land for, erect, equip, furnish, maintain, and operate a joint municipal and recreation building or joint recreational and athletic field to be used jointly by such school district and city.

Legislative History
Source: Laws 1953, c. 37, § 1, p. 128; Laws 1955, c. 39, § 1, p. 152; Laws 1961, c. 47, § 1, p. 184.
